Penicillin allergies are fairly common, but vary widely in severity. Also, some people get side effects from medications but report them as allergies. If you get a rash, swelling, tingling, or difficulty breathing, those are early signs of anaphylaxis.
Amoxicillin is one of many forms of Penicillin, so if you are actually allergic to any Penicillin, you are actually allergic to every Penicillin.
